Howdy, I just cant wait any longer and need to grow, however i live in an apt, so a big nice grow tent is out of the question right now.

Ive been skimming around and i was wondering if there is a company out there that has micro grow boxes/tents already set up and ready to go and i can just put my seeds in and start? I dont trust myself to build something where nothing will leak out, nor do i have the patience.

Also, ive seen a lot about leaving your seedlings in red solo cup? Is there something wrong with having the taproot sprout and then sticking them in the pot they are going to grow in right away? I figure less transplants, less stress..

Also, all things equal, what kind of yield are you looking at doing one of these micro grows? I am what they call, a "heavy user" . Thanks guys.

It depends on how short you go and how many plants you run... I've seen some grow boxes and they are expensive... Tents will leak light too...I built on in an armoir, clones & veg on one side, flower on the other... LED with a scrubber and 4" can fan... It works best going from small clones clones and adding a couple a week in the red cups...I use a wick in the bottom of cups of Coco & perlite and Jack's Hydroponic... Very simple system with a perpetual harvest.

It's hard to throw seeds and grow good bud in a small space with little patience. Having done the apartment thing I can tell you it can be done but it's kind of inconvenient. Also, you will not harvest much and you'll need a butt load of patience. If you want an easy way to get it going buying a $1000 grow box might be your best bet. You'll still need to tend to your plants but with a hydro set up in a grow box you probably won't need to do much other than make sure there's water, clean it sometimes (IPM) and add nutrients. You'll probably get an ounce or two of mediocre weed every 90 days using auto seeds in a grow box. I have a superbox. It's awesome and will grow plants. That said you should only grow one at a time as they blow up in there. I would recommend fimming and heavy training to keep it small as you can. The other issue is that you need to pipe in cold air to the box or keep the box in a room with high 60 degree temps else the plant will fry. The carbon scrubber works fine if you keep the door closed...I am unable to do so, but I don't have that smell worry here. I keep the door open and blow more air in via a floor fan. My suggestion would be to save up and get the taller cabinet as that will handle heat better. I would also suggest auto flowers in hydro, but you need a ton of patience.

You can get small tents and a tent is way easier than a box imho. They come with holes for everything.
I use a 48 x 48 x 80 inch tent and a 20 x 36 x 60 and you can get them 4 feet tall 2 x 2 or 1 x 3.

Boxes work good too but remember the filter has to go somewhere. If stealth is the issue you need a GOOD scrubber.

Build two small boxes.. paint white. Have them use the same passive airflow off small inline or puter fans. Veg and bloom.. or mother and bloom. Screw in cfls and leds if your cheap. Homemade carbon filter and a squirt of ozone juice spray shit now and then (not at the plants) and you are minty. If you smoke weed at all, that will stink up more than the grow boxes. peakseedsbc sweet c99 beans (very mild floral smell. Does not smell like weed in a way folks recognize.)
More important than all of this.. if you tell anyone, you defeated the point of stealth cabbage..
